Steel Smiling bridges the gap between Black people and mental health support through education, advocacy, and awareness. Our 10-year vision is to expose every Black person in the country to a positive mental health experience that improves their Quality of Life by 2050. We're currently in a fiscal sponsor partnership with Neighborhood Allies. This strategic collaboration directly strengthens our financial management practices, board governance procedures, and program delivery framework.
Our Mental Health Workforce Development Program (Beams to Bridges) equips Black adults with the knowledge, skills, and competencies needed to serve as Community Mental Health Advocates. While completing the programmatic experience, cohort members receive the following: weekly workforce stipends, emergency financial assistance, mental health training, behavioral health treatment, and social service support.
Additionally, our Black Mental Health Referral Program helps Black community members offset costs related to receiving mental health support and services.
Finally, our Steel Thriving Youth Mental Health Program provides Black, high school-aged youth with weekly opportunities to cope with stressors related to racism, Covid-19, and police brutality.
